Just nu i M3-nätverket
Gå till innehåll

Konfiguration av Apache


S T

Rekommendera Poster

Hej!

 

Vet inte riktigt om denna fråga hör hemma i detta forum, men jag gör ett försök...

 

Det är så att jag har ett litet problem med min apache konfiguration. När jag anger en sökväg till en mapp, t ex http://domain/test/'>http://domain/test/ måste sista slashen vara med. Det jag har problem med är att konfigurera apache så att det ska räcka att skriva http://domain/test för att komma åt index.htm i mappen test, dvs bli av med slashen i slutet.

 

Av vad jag läst så ska detta gå att åtgärda med hjälp av Alias. Men det jag inte förstår är hur jag ska skriva Aliaset och vart jag ska placera detta tillägg i konfigurationsfilen.

 

Hjälp mottages tacksamt!!!!

 

Länk till kommentar
Dela på andra webbplatser

Vanligtvis beror det på att man har använt Alias utan att läsa instruktionerna.

 

Så här står det i conf-filen:

# Aliases: Add here as many aliases as you need (with no limit). The format is 
# Alias fakename realname
#
# Note that if you include a trailing / on fakename then the server will
# require it to be present in the URL.  
#

Vilket alltså betyder att om du har

Alias /test/ "c:/temp/testsiten"

så räcker det inte med att skriva http://domain/test

Om du däremot skriver

Alias /test "c:/temp/testsiten"

Så funkar det.

 

Om du inte använder alias överhuvudtaget borde det fungera automatiskt.

 

 

Länk till kommentar
Dela på andra webbplatser

Tack för ditt svar! Jag använder inte alias överhuvudtaget och det gör mig konfunderad. Det borde fungera som du själv påpekar automatiskt.

 

Har du något annat förslag?

 

Länk till kommentar
Dela på andra webbplatser

Är det varken Alias eller SetServername som ställer till det så skulle jag rekomendera att du tittade i fel-loggen.

 

 

Länk till kommentar
Dela på andra webbplatser

Vad ska ska titta efter i loggen?

Fel och/eller information som skrivs ut i loggarna (både access- och error-log) när du begär sidan.

Om jag visste vilket fel som skulle synas så skulle du ju inte behöva titta där.

 

 

Länk till kommentar
Dela på andra webbplatser

Gunnar Dahlström

Har du gjort detta?

 

Add a ServerName directive to the config file to tell it what the domain name of the server is

 

Länk till kommentar
Dela på andra webbplatser

Arkiverat

Det här ämnet är nu arkiverat och är stängt för ytterligare svar.

×
×
  • Skapa nytt...